遍历key值:


a = {'a':'1','b':'2','c':'3'}
for i in a:
    print(i+':'+a[i])


输出:

a:1
 b:2
 c:3 
a = {'a':'1','b':'2','c':'3'}
for i in a.keys():
    print(i+':'+a[i])


等同于上面

遍历value值:


a = {'a':'1','b':'2','c':'3'}
for value in a.values():
    print(value)


输出:

1
 2
 3

遍历字典项:


a = {'a':'1','b':'2','c':'3'}
for key_value in a.items():
    print(key_value)


输出:

('a', '1')
 ('b', '2')
 ('c', '3')

遍历键值对:


a = {'a':'1','b':'2','c':'3'}
for key,value in a.items():#等同于for (key,value) in a.items():
    print(key+":"+value)


输出:

a:1
 b:2
 c:3